Williams-Sonoma, Inc. (NYSE:WSM) Shares Acquired by Teacher Retirement System of Texas

Teacher Retirement System of Texas boosted its holdings in shares of Williams-Sonoma, Inc. (NYSE:WSM - Free Report) by 3.7% during the fourth quarter, according to the company in its most recent disclosure with the Securities & Exchange Commission. The institutional investor owned 246,066 shares of the specialty retailer's stock after purchasing an additional 8,855 shares during the quarter. Teacher Retirement System of Texas owned about 0.20% of Williams-Sonoma worth $45,567,000 as of its most recent SEC filing.

Several other institutional investors have also bought and sold shares of WSM. Harvest Fund Management Co. Ltd bought a new position in Williams-Sonoma during the fourth quarter valued at $1,920,000. Vinva Investment Management Ltd bought a new position in Williams-Sonoma during the 4th quarter valued at about $2,566,000. Xponance Inc. raised its position in Williams-Sonoma by 7.3% in the 4th quarter. Xponance Inc. now owns 28,548 shares of the specialty retailer's stock worth $5,287,000 after purchasing an additional 1,946 shares during the period. Generali Asset Management SPA SGR purchased a new position in shares of Williams-Sonoma during the fourth quarter valued at approximately $2,052,000. Finally, Kensington Investment Counsel LLC grew its stake in shares of Williams-Sonoma by 1.6% during the fourth quarter. Kensington Investment Counsel LLC now owns 51,266 shares of the specialty retailer's stock valued at $9,493,000 after buying an additional 820 shares during the last quarter. Institutional investors own 99.29% of the company's stock.

Williams-Sonoma Stock Down 0.7 %

Shares of WSM traded down $1.20 during midday trading on Tuesday, reaching $169.10. The company had a trading volume of 1,902,362 shares, compared to its average volume of 1,917,684. Williams-Sonoma, Inc. has a 1-year low of $125.33 and a 1-year high of $219.98. The firm has a 50 day simple moving average of $196.63 and a 200-day simple moving average of $172.90. The stock has a market cap of $20.82 billion, a PE ratio of 20.00, a price-to-earnings-growth ratio of 2.89 and a beta of 1.82.

Williams-Sonoma (NYSE:WSM - Get Free Report) last announced its quarterly earnings results on Wednesday, March 19th. The specialty retailer reported $3.28 EPS for the quarter, beating the consensus estimate of $2.88 by $0.40. The business had revenue of $2.46 billion for the quarter, compared to analyst estimates of $2.34 billion. Williams-Sonoma had a return on equity of 51.56% and a net margin of 14.54%. The company's quarterly revenue was up 8.0% on a year-over-year basis. During the same quarter in the prior year, the company posted $5.44 EPS. As a group, sell-side analysts anticipate that Williams-Sonoma, Inc. will post 8.36 earnings per share for the current fiscal year.

Williams-Sonoma Increases Dividend

The firm also recently declared a quarterly dividend, which will be paid on Saturday, May 24th. Shareholders of record on Thursday, April 17th will be paid a $0.66 dividend. This is an increase from Williams-Sonoma's previous quarterly dividend of $0.57. The ex-dividend date of this dividend is Thursday, April 17th. This represents a $2.64 annualized dividend and a dividend yield of 1.56%. Williams-Sonoma's payout ratio is 29.30%.

Insider Buying and Selling at Williams-Sonoma

In other news, CEO Laura Alber sold 45,000 shares of the company's stock in a transaction dated Tuesday, January 21st. The shares were sold at an average price of $207.76, for a total value of $9,349,200.00. Following the completion of the sale, the chief executive officer now directly owns 944,666 shares of the company's stock, valued at approximately $196,263,808.16. This represents a 4.55 % decrease in their ownership of the stock. The sale was disclosed in a filing with the Securities & Exchange Commission, which is accessible through this hyperlink. Also, CFO Jeffrey Howie sold 1,408 shares of Williams-Sonoma stock in a transaction on Thursday, February 27th. The shares were sold at an average price of $194.32, for a total transaction of $273,602.56. Following the completion of the transaction, the chief financial officer now owns 46,388 shares in the company, valued at approximately $9,014,116.16. This trade represents a 2.95 % decrease in their ownership of the stock. The disclosure for this sale can be found here. 1.50% of the stock is owned by corporate insiders.

Wall Street Analysts Forecast Growth

A number of brokerages have recently commented on WSM. UBS Group raised shares of Williams-Sonoma from a "sell" rating to a "neutral" rating and raised their target price for the stock from $140.00 to $165.00 in a research report on Thursday, March 20th. Jefferies Financial Group lowered their price target on shares of Williams-Sonoma from $226.00 to $208.00 and set a "buy" rating for the company in a research report on Thursday, March 20th. Wells Fargo & Company cut their price objective on shares of Williams-Sonoma from $195.00 to $170.00 and set an "equal weight" rating on the stock in a report on Thursday, March 20th. Barclays raised their price target on shares of Williams-Sonoma from $123.00 to $131.00 and gave the company an "underweight" rating in a report on Thursday, March 13th. Finally, Gordon Haskett upgraded shares of Williams-Sonoma to a "hold" rating in a research note on Thursday, February 13th. One equities research analyst has rated the stock with a sell rating, thirteen have issued a hold rating and four have given a buy rating to the stock. According to data from MarketBeat.com, the company has a consensus rating of "Hold" and a consensus target price of $177.93.

About Williams-Sonoma

Williams-Sonoma, Inc operates as an omni-channel specialty retailer of various products for home. It offers cooking, dining, and entertaining products, such as cookware, tools, electrics, cutlery, tabletop and bar, outdoor, furniture, and a library of cookbooks under the Williams Sonoma Home brand, as well as home furnishings and decorative accessories under the Williams Sonoma lifestyle brand; and furniture, bedding, lighting, rugs, table essentials, and decorative accessories under the Pottery Barn brand.
